[0023] Below in conjunction with accompanying drawing, the present invention is described in further detail:

[0024] Figure 1 to Figure 4 Shown: The packing sheet is stamped from a composite plate composed of two layers of wire mesh sandwiched by a thin plate. The material of the composite plate can be stainless steel, aluminum, titanium, Hastelloy and other metals, or PTFE, PP, Non-metals such as plastic or carbon fiber; windows are opened on the crests and troughs of the corrugated packing sheet, and holes are opened on the wave surface of the packing sheet. The hole diameter of the wire mesh in the composite board is 0.04mm-0.25mm, the mesh number is 250-40 mesh, and the thickness of the thin plate is 0.05mm-0.2mm. Abstract

The invention provides a windowed flow guide type sheet and structured packing. The windowed flow guide type sheet is characterized in that a packing sheet is a composite plate, a layer of thin platesis sandwiched between two layers of screens to form the composite plate, wave crests and wave troughs of the ripple packing sheet are windowed, and holes are formed in wave surfaces between the wavecrests and the wave troughs of the packing sheets. Windows at the wave crests and the wave troughs of the packing sheet comprise flow guide window bodies and window apertures; the windows on the wavecrests and the wave troughs are arranged on a horizontal line, the distance from an optional window to the adjacent upper window is equal to the distance from the optional window to the adjacent lowerwindow in the vertical direction, and the optional window, the adjacent upper window and the adjacent lower window are arranged on a vertical line. The structured packing comprises a plurality of packing sheets with parallelly arrayed ripples and a wall flow preventive ring. The windowed flow guide type sheet and the structured packing have the advantages that all merits of existing windowed flowguide packing are inherited, the windowed flow guide type sheet and the structured packing have large specific surface areas and are effective in wettability, uniform liquid distribution and liquid film updating can be reinforced, dead spaces in the packing can be diminished, and the mass transfer efficiency can be obviously improved.

Description

technical field [0001] The invention relates to a structured packing in the gas-liquid mass transfer process of a chemical industry, in particular to a window-opening flow-guiding packing sheet and a structured packing used in unit operations such as rectification, absorption, and extraction. Background technique [0002] Structured packing is a kind of packing that is arranged in a uniform pattern in the packed tower and stacked neatly. It specifies the gas-liquid flow path, improves channel flow and wall flow, has the advantages of low pressure drop and high specific surface area, and can achieve higher mass and heat transfer effects in the same volume. There are many types of structured packing, which can be divided into wire mesh corrugated packing, plate corrugated packing and mesh corrugated packing according to the structure of the material.
